Guide to Teaching Computer Science


Book Description

This textbook presents both a conceptual framework and detailed implementation guidelines for computer science (CS) teaching. Updated with the latest teaching approaches and trends, and expanded with new learning activities, the content of this new edition is clearly written and structured to be applicable to all levels of CS education and for any teaching organization. Features: provides 110 detailed learning activities; reviews curriculum and cross-curriculum topics in CS; explores the benefits of CS education research; describes strategies for cultivating problem-solving skills, for assessing learning processes, and for dealing with pupils’ misunderstandings; proposes active-learning-based classroom teaching methods, including lab-based teaching; discusses various types of questions that a CS instructor or trainer can use for a range of teaching situations; investigates thoroughly issues of lesson planning and course design; examines the first field teaching experiences gained by CS teachers.




Computers in the Classroom


Book Description

Since 1979, Apple Computer's Educational Grants program has provided computer equipment and training to schools through a nationwide competitive process. Computers in the Classroom tells the inspiring stories of some of these schools, showing how technology has revived the classroom. This illustrated book is an indispensable resource for teachers and parents, showing examples of students' work and with information on funding resources, technical support, software, and where to find electric and print data. 100 illus.




Teaching, Learning, and Leading With Computer Simulations


Book Description

Computer simulation, a powerful technological tool and research-proven pedagogical technique, holds great potential to enhance and transform teaching and learning in education and is therefore a viable tool to engage students in deep learning and higher-order thinking. With the advancement of simulation technology (e.g., virtual reality, artificial intelligence, machine learning) and the expanded disciplines where computer simulation is being used (e.g., data science, cyber security), computer simulation is playing an increasingly significant role in leading the digital transformation in K-12 schools and higher education institutions, as well as training and professional development in corporations, government, and the military. Teaching, Learning, and Leading With Computer Simulations is an important compilation of research that examines the recent advancement of simulation technology and explores innovative ways to utilize advanced simulation programs for the enhancement of teaching and learning outcomes. Highlighting a range of topics such as pedagogy, immersive learning, and social sciences, this book is essential for educators, higher education institutions, deans, curriculum designers, school administrators, principals, IT specialists, academicians, researchers, policymakers, and students.




Learning with Computers


Book Description

Grade level: 4, 5, 6, 7, 8, 9, e, i, s, t.







Reflections on the History of Computers in Education


Book Description

This book is a collection of refereed invited papers on the history of computing in education from the 1970s to the mid-1990s presenting a social history of the introduction and early use of computers in schools. The 30 papers deal with the introduction of computer in schools in many countries around the world: Norway, South Africa, UK, Canada, Australia, USA, Finland, Chile, The Netherlands, New Zealand, Spain, Ireland, Israel and Poland. The authors are not professional historians but rather people who as teachers, students or researchers were involved in this history and they narrate their experiences from a personal perspective offering fascinating stories.







Computers in Education


Book Description

"Computers in Education" is designed to help teachers use computer technology to increase the efficiency and effectiveness of the educational process. Copyright © Libri GmbH. All rights reserved.




Computer-Assisted Foreign Language Teaching and Learning: Technological Advances


Book Description

Educational technologies continue to advance the ways in which we teach and learn. As these technologies continue to improve our communication with one another, computer-assisted foreign language learning has provided a more efficient way of communication between different languages. Computer-Assisted Foreign Language Teaching and Learning: Technological Advances highlights new research and an original framework that brings together foreign language teaching, experiments and testing practices that utilize the most recent and widely used e-learning resources. This comprehensive collection of research will offer linguistic scholars, language teachers, students, and policymakers a better understanding of the importance and influence of e-learning in second language acquisition.




Teaching and Learning about Computers


Book Description

Technology provides ample opportunities for teachers to be learners, as well as for the learners to become the teachers. Sometimes, the most effective technology enabled classrooms are those where the instructor is the expert in the content area, and the students are the technology experts. Oftentimes it is with a great sense of pride that a student will show a teacher how to adroitly move about in an application. Designed for both instructors and students, this book teaches an array of computer applications while simultaneously allowing the user to become proficient in technological standards. Based on Joanne Barrett's notes and shortcuts from her years as a computer specialist and computer teacher, this all-inclusive hands-on guide will assist teachers and students in grades 5 through 12 who are using computers in the classroom. Explaining concepts and complicated processes in an understandable language, this complete instructional tool covers in one volume all of the computer topics that the teacher will encounter. Topics include: - Word processing - Spreadsheets - Creating charts and graphs - Databases - Multimedia presentations - The Internet - Web page design - Programming - Viruses and copyright issues